About 7 Alfriston Close
7 Alfriston Close is a three-bedroom detached house in Worthing (BN14 7QT). It has a recorded floor area of 95 m² (around 1023 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(July 2018) shows a C (score 70). When first surveyed in October 2010 the rating was D,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, lighting went from Average to Good; while wall efficiency dropped from Good to Average and roof ef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 84).
It hasn't traded since December 2010, a hold of 15 years that's notably long for the area. At 95 m² the property is well over the postcode median (73 m² across 12 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Its energy rating outperforms most of the postcode (better than 83% of similar EPCs). Across 2001–2010, sale prices on this property compounded at 6.8%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£465,000 sits 86% above the 2010 sale of £250,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£244/sq ft) was about 27.6% below the postcode norm.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2002.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ved.
